Output 329cbfd3feb6bb8718c75cabb44c4245a2158cd7631d55a7d221ec90559a80ee:0

value
51419946
script pubkey
OP_0 OP_PUSHBYTES_20 ce2e4339b2e8ef86a9c7b13435152da6b31427d8
address
bc1qechyxwdjarhcd2w8ky6r29fd56e3gf7cqejyls
transaction
329cbfd3feb6bb8718c75cabb44c4245a2158cd7631d55a7d221ec90559a80ee
spent
true